Recognizing Where Waste Begins



Before modifications can be made, it's important to determine where waste is taking place in your workflow. Commonly, this begins with a detailed assessment of resources use. Scrap metal, declined parts, and unneeded second procedures all contribute to loss. These issues may come from improperly made tooling, inconsistencies in die positioning, or inadequate upkeep routines.



When a component does not satisfy specification, it does not just impact the material expense. There's additionally wasted time, labor, and power associated with running an entire batch through the press. Shops that make the initiative to detect the resource of variant-- whether it's with the tool configuration or operator technique-- frequently find simple opportunities to reduce waste significantly.



Tooling Precision: The Foundation of Efficiency



Precision in tooling is the cornerstone of reliable marking. If dies are out of placement or put on beyond tolerance, waste comes to be unpreventable. Top notch tool maintenance, normal assessments, and investing in exact dimension techniques can all expand tool life and reduce worldly loss.



One way Northeast Ohio stores can tighten their process is by taking another look at the tool design itself. Small changes in exactly how the part is set out or how the strip proceeds via the die can produce big results. For example, enhancing clearance in strike and die collections helps prevent burrs and guarantees cleaner sides. Much better edges imply less defective parts and much less post-processing.



In some cases, shops have actually had success by shifting from single-hit tooling to compound stamping, which combines several procedures into one press stroke. This technique not just quickens production however additionally reduces handling and component imbalance, both of which are resources of unnecessary waste.



Improving Material Flow with Smarter Layouts



Product circulation plays a significant role in stamping effectiveness. If your production line is littered or if materials have to travel too far between stages, you're losing time and raising the threat of damage or contamination.



One way to decrease waste is to look carefully at just how products get in and leave the marking line. Are coils being loaded smoothly? Are blanks stacked in a way that avoids scraping or bending? Easy modifications to the design-- like minimizing the range between presses or producing devoted paths for finished goods-- can improve rate and minimize managing damages.



One more smart strategy is to take into consideration switching over from hand-fed presses to transfer stamping systems, especially for larger or much more complex components. These systems immediately move components in between stations, reducing labor, minimizing handling, and maintaining parts aligned via every step of the process. Over time, that uniformity assists reduced scrap prices and improve result.



Die Design: Balancing Durability and Accuracy



Pass away style plays a central duty in exactly how effectively a store can decrease waste. A properly designed die is durable, simple to maintain, and with the ability of producing regular results over hundreds of cycles. However also the very best die can underperform if it had not been developed with the details requirements of the component in mind.



For parts that entail complex kinds or tight tolerances, stores may need to buy specialized form dies that form product a lot more gradually, minimizing the chance of tearing or wrinkling. Although this may call for more thorough planning upfront, the long-lasting advantages in decreased scrap and longer device life are frequently well worth the financial investment.



Additionally, thinking about the sort of steel used in the die and the warm therapy procedure can enhance performance. Long lasting products may cost more initially, yet they often settle by needing less repairs and replacements. Shops ought to likewise plan ahead to make passes away modular or very easy to readjust, so small changes in part design don't require a full tool rebuild.



Training and Communication on the Shop Floor



Typically, among one of the most ignored sources of waste is a breakdown in interaction. If drivers aren't totally educated on equipment setups, appropriate positioning, or part assessment, even the best tooling and design will not protect against concerns. Shops that focus on regular training and cross-functional collaboration usually see far better uniformity across changes.



Developing a society where staff members feel responsible for top quality-- and encouraged to make modifications or report problems-- can help in reducing waste before it begins. Data-Driven Decisions for Long-Term Impact



Among the smartest tools a shop can make use of to cut waste is data. By tracking scrap prices, downtime, and product use over time, it ends up being a lot easier to identify patterns and weak points while doing so. With this information, shops can make calculated choices concerning where to spend time, training, or capital.



For instance, if data reveals that a details component always has high scrap rates, you can trace it back to a particular tool, shift, or device. From there, it's possible to identify what requires to be dealt with. Possibly it's a lubrication concern. Possibly the device requires change. Or possibly a mild redesign would certainly make a large distinction.



Also without expensive software program, stores can gather insights with an easy spreadsheet and consistent coverage. With time, these understandings can lead smarter buying, much better training, and much more efficient maintenance timetables.
